2 Installation and Wiring
Some times Dangerous voltages capable of causing death are present in this instrument. Before
doing installation or any troubleshooting procedures the power to the equipment must be switched off and
isolated. Units suspected of being faulty must be disconnected and removed to a properly equipped
workshop for testing and repair. Component replacement and internal adjustments must be made by a
qualified maintenance person only.
To minimize the possibility of fire or shock hazards, do not expose this instrument to rain or
excessive moisture
Do not use this instrument in areas under hazardous conditions such as excessive shock,
vibration, dirt, moisture, corrosive gases or oil. The ambient temperature of the areas should not
exceed the maximum rating specified in the specification
2.1 Unpacking
Upon receipt of the shipment remove the unit from the carton and inspect the unit for
shipping damage. If any damage found then contact local representative immediately. Note the
model number, serial number for future reference when corresponding with our service center. The
serial number (S/N) is labeled on the box and the housing of Paperless Recorder
Remove stains from this equipment using a soft, dry cloth. Do not use harsh chemicals,
volatile solvents such as thinner or strong detergents to clean the equipment in order to avoid
deformation.
The Paperless Recorder is designed for indoor use and not in any hazardous area. It
should be kept away from shock, vibration, and electromagnetic fields such as variable frequency
drives, motors and transformers. It is intended to operate under the following environmental
conditions.
Environmental Parameter Specification
Operating Temperature 0°C to 50 °C
Humidity 20% to 90% RH(Non-condensing)
Altitude 2000 M Maximum
Table 2-1.Environmental Specification
